Abstract: Abstract Quality function deployment (QFD) is a customer-driven product development tool used to convert customer requirements into engineering characteristics to maximize customer satisfaction. In real applications, however, the traditional QFD method has been criticized as having lots of deficiencies. Over the past decades, many models and approaches have been suggested for improving QFD, but a paucity of contributions are devoted to review and summarize the related researches on the basis of bibliometric analysis. In this paper, we conduct a comprehensive bibliometric analysis of the journal articles on QFD improvement during the years of 1999–2020. First, the metadata analysis of identified articles was presented to clarify the research progress and development trend in this field. Then, bibliometric analyses of the selected articles are conducted to identify the most prolific and influential researchers, the most productive institutions and their collaborations, and the intellectual structure of studies in QFD development. Via keyword analysis, the research focuses and emerging research trends for QFD improvement are found out. Finally, blind spots and future research directions in the area are summarized to provide valuable reference for the future research of QFD advancement.
